Context
The dataset tabulates the population of Peterborough town by gender, including both male and female populations. This dataset can be utilized to understand the population distribution of Peterborough town across both sexes and to determine which sex constitutes the majority.
Key observations
There is a slight majority of female population, with 52.14% of total population being female. Source: U.S. Census Bureau American Community Survey (ACS) 2019-2023 5-Year Estimates.
When available, the data consists of estimates from the U.S. Census Bureau American Community Survey (ACS) 2019-2023 5-Year Estimates.
Scope of gender :
Please note that American Community Survey asks a question about the respondents current sex, but not about gender, sexual orientation, or sex at birth. The question is intended to capture data for biological sex, not gender. Respondents are supposed to respond with the answer as either of Male or Female. Our research and this dataset mirrors the data reported as Male and Female for gender distribution analysis. No further analysis is done on the data reported from the Census Bureau.

Towns in Time is a compilation of time series data for Victoria's towns covering the years 1981 to 2011. The data is based on Census data collected by the Australian Bureau of Statistics. Towns in Time presents 2011 data for the 2011 definition of each town, together with data under the 2006 definition for 2006 and earlier years. A map showing the difference in the town's boundaries between 2006 and 2011 is attached to each data sheet. It is recommended the user assess this concordance when using time series data.
Statistics Canada Census 2021 Age (in single years), average age and median age and gender within the Peterborough census division. Townships in the County of Peterborough and First Nations reserves are mapped as census subdivisions. The City of Peterborough is also a census subdivision but because of its higher population, the City is mapped by census tracts and one dissemination area neighbourhood to fit within the City boundary.Statistics Canada note on gender:Gender refers to an individual's personal and social identity as a man, woman or non-binary person (a person who is not exclusively a man or a woman).Gender includes the following concepts:gender identity, which refers to the gender that a person feels internally and individually;gender expression, which refers to the way a person presents their gender, regardless of their gender identity, through body language, aesthetic choices or accessories (e.g., clothes, hairstyle and makeup), which may have traditionally been associated with a specific gender.A person's gender may differ from their sex at birth, and from what is indicated on their current identification or legal documents such as their birth certificate, passport or driver's licence. A person's gender may change over time.Some people may not identify with a specific gender.Given that the non-binary population is small, data aggregation to a two-category gender variable is sometimes necessary to protect the confidentiality of responses provided. In these cases, individuals in the category "non-binary persons" are distributed into the other two gender categories and are denoted by the "+" symbol."Men+" includes men (and/or boys), as well as some non-binary persons."Women+" includes women (and/or girls), as well as some non-binary persons.

Context
The dataset tabulates the Peterborough town population distribution across 18 age groups. It lists the population in each age group along with the percentage population relative of the total population for Peterborough town. The dataset can be utilized to understand the population distribution of Peterborough town by age. For example, using this dataset, we can identify the largest age group in Peterborough town.
Key observations
The largest age group in Peterborough, New Hampshire was for the group of age 50 to 54 years years with a population of 701 (10.91%), according to the ACS 2018-2022 5-Year Estimates. At the same time, the smallest age group in Peterborough, New Hampshire was the 5 to 9 years years with a population of 151 (2.35%). Source: U.S. Census Bureau American Community Survey (ACS) 2018-2022 5-Year Estimates

Overall, the participation rate in Peterborough, ON is declining at a rate of 0.11% per year over the past 15 years from 2001 to 2016. In the last two census, its participation rates declined by 0.6%, an average growth rate of -0.12% per year from 2011 to 2016. A decrease in participation rate means the proportion of the working population in Peterborough, ON is lower than in the past.
